Hatch’s Dealings with BCCI Figures Probed: The dealings of Sen. Orrin Hatch (R-Utah) with two men linked to the Bank of Credit & Commerce International scandal are being investigated by law enforcement officials, sources said. Hatch was involved in business deals with Houston entrepreneur Munzer Hourani, and met several times with Mohammed Hammoud, a Lebanese businessman, the sources said. Both men are linked to the bank, at the center of a worldwide scandal involving alleged drug money laundering, arms trafficking and support of terrorists.
